Skip to content

Commit 8590230

Browse files
author
mydicebot
committed
fix primedice precision issue
1 parent 0f3f2ba commit 8590230

File tree

2 files changed

+7
-4
lines changed

2 files changed

+7
-4
lines changed

README.md

Lines changed: 4 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-40,13 +40,16 @@
4040
* Source Code: [https://github.com/mydicebot/mydicebot.github.io](https://github.com/mydicebot/mydicebot.github.io)
4141

4242
# Supporting Dice Sites (alphabet sequence)
43+
## Traditional
4344
* [999Dice](https://www.999dice.com/?224280708)
4445
* [Bitsler](https://www.bitsler.com/?ref=mydicebot)
4546
* [Crypto-Games](https://www.crypto-games.net?i=CpQP3V8Up2)
46-
* [MagicDice](https://magic-dice.com/?ref=mydicebot)
4747
* [PrimeDice](https://primedice.com/?c=mydicebot)
4848
* [Stake](https://stake.com/?code=mydicebot)
4949
* [YoloDice](https://yolodice.com/r?6fAf-wVz)
50+
## Blockchain - STEEM
51+
* [EpicDice](https://epicdice.io/?ref=mydicebot)
52+
* [MagicDice](https://magic-dice.com/?ref=mydicebot)
5053

5154
# TODO
5255
* [BetKing (coming soon)](https://betking.io/?ref=u:mydicebot)

src/api/models/prime.js

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-113,11 +113,11 @@ export class PrimeDice extends BaseDice {
113113
let currency = req.body.Currency.toLowerCase();
114114
let target = 0;
115115
if(req.body.High == 1){
116-
target = 999999-Math.floor((req.body.Chance*10000))+1;
116+
target = 9999-Math.floor((req.body.Chance*100));
117117
} else {
118-
target = Math.floor((req.body.Chance*10000))-1;
118+
target = Math.floor((req.body.Chance*100));
119119
}
120-
target = parseFloat(target/10000).toFixed(2);
120+
target = parseFloat(target/100).toFixed(2);
121121
let data = " mutation{primediceRoll(amount:"+amount+",target:"+target+",condition:"+ condition +",currency:"+currency+ ") { id iid nonce currency amount payout state { ... on BetGamePrimedice { result target condition } } createdAt serverSeed{seedHash seed nonce} clientSeed{seed} user{balances{available{amount currency}} statistic{game bets wins losses amount profit currency}}}}";
122122
let ret = await this._send('', 'POST', data, req.session.accessToken);
123123
let info = req.session.info;

0 commit comments

Comments
 (0)